Transaction 20edde566dd97da7e87fc1ff93aa585963aa4eae94680beae8c0beb9f890bbc7

1 Input
2 Outputs
  • 20edde566dd97da7e87fc1ff93aa585963aa4eae94680beae8c0beb9f890bbc7:0
  • value  758416
    address  3NYRpcW1FLGKLnNS9Gn7w8Zqt1Jn4Q3mh9
  • 20edde566dd97da7e87fc1ff93aa585963aa4eae94680beae8c0beb9f890bbc7:1
  • value  25235694
    address  34nrK1qsfPcvAFEcXTr8xFMxaJPB45Dvt4